How to Install and Uninstall rav1e Package on Ubuntu 23.10 (Mantic Minotaur)

Last updated: May 20,2024

1. Install "rav1e"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to install rav1e on Ubuntu 23.10 (Mantic Minotaur)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install rav1e

2. Uninstall "rav1e"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to uninstall rav1e on Ubuntu 23.10 (Mantic Minotaur):

$ sudo apt remove rav1e $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
